Parts with protrusions or depressions in certain areas

Some parts are partially protruding or recessed. For those that require thickening and chrome plating, they should still maintain sharp right angles. The chrome plating of these parts is quite challenging. When the protruding part of the part undergoes chrome plating, the electric current is concentrated in the protruding part, causing the current in other parts to be too small, resulting in a thin chrome coating.

At this point, the chromium coating obtained is difficult to maintain uniformity, and the chromium coating at the root is even thinner. Therefore, after each thickening of the chromium coating and subsequent grinding process, it is difficult to grind out the root part.

How should these recessed and protruding parts be plated? As a hard chrome additive manufacturer, Bigley suggests that electroplating factories can use auxiliary anodes or segmented plating (first plating the recessed and protruding parts, then the outer circle; or first plating the outer circle, then the recessed and protruding parts). This method can ensure that the chrome coating reaches a certain thickness uniformly.

The surface of the part has holes

During the application of hard chrome additives, sometimes there are small holes in the chrome-coated part of the parts. After thickening the chrome coating, the chromium layer around the holes is too thin, and sometimes there is no chromium coating at all. This is mainly because the area at the holes increases, resulting in a decrease in current density. At the same time, the electric current lines are difficult to be evenly distributed, thus making it difficult to deposit chromium.
